Output 86aa5d4d5ee67ca475b46e210e37c16f7ed7188768fe68ae5fcb649df8183673:1

value
23152545
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43a8d0203634d4c99c0bcc658c6a4591583f3646131429c1dde73dfbc734e7aa
address
bc1pgw5dqgpkxn2vn8qte3jcc6j9j9vr7djxzv2znswauu7lh3e5u74qrmcvqw
transaction
86aa5d4d5ee67ca475b46e210e37c16f7ed7188768fe68ae5fcb649df8183673
spent
true